Blood on Snow
Author(s): Jo Nesbo
From the internationally acclaimed author of the Harry Hole novels--a fast, tight, darkly lyrical stand-alone novel that has at its center the perfectly sympathetic antihero: an Oslo contract killer who draws us into an unexpected meditation on death and love. This is the story of Olav: an extremely talented "fixer" for one of Oslo's most powerful crime bosses. But Olav is also an unusually complicated fixer. He has a capacity for love that is as far-reaching as is his gift for murder. He is our straightforward, calm-in-the-face-of-crisis narrator with a storyteller's hypnotic knack for fantasy. He has an "innate talent for subordination" but running through his veins is a "virus" born of the power over life and death. And while his latest job puts him at the pinnacle of his trade, it may be mutating into his greatest mistake. . . . "From the Hardcover edition."

JO NESBO is a musician, songwriter, economist, as well as a writer. His Harry Hole novels include "The Redeemer," "The Snowman," "The Leopard," and "Phantom," and he is also the author of several stand-alone novels and the Doctor Proctor series of children's books. He is the recipient of numerous awards including the Glass Key for best Nordic crime novel.
